For the 2025 school year, there are 2 public high schools serving 1,337 students in the neighborhood of Weston Ranch, Manteca, CA.
The top ranked public high schools in Weston Ranch are Weston Ranch High School and New Vision High School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
The neighborhood of Weston Ranch, Manteca, CA public high schools have an average math proficiency score of 12% (versus the California public high school average of 28%), and reading proficiency score of 36% (versus the 51% statewide average).
the neighborhood of Weston Ranch, Manteca, CA public high school have a Graduation Rate of 84%, which is less than the California average of 87%.
The school with highest graduation rate is Weston Ranch High School, with 92% graduation rate. Read more about public school graduation rate statistics in California or national school graduation rate statistics.
Minority enrollment is 94%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is more than the California public high school average of 79% (majority Hispanic).
